MagumeriAudio file "Magumeri.ogg" not found is a Local Government Area of Borno State, Nigeria. Its headquarters are in the town of Magumeri.

It has an area of 4,856 km2 and a population of 140,231 at the 2006 census.

The postal code of the area is 602.[1]

It is one of the sixteen LGAs that constitute the Borno Emirate, a traditional state located in Borno State, Nigeria.[2]

Climate/ Geography

[edit | edit source]

Magumeri LGA has an average temperature of 33 degrees Celsius and a total area of 4,856 square kilometers. Within the LGA, there is an average wind speed of 11 km/h and an estimated 800 mm of precipitation annually.[3]

Notable people

[edit | edit source]
  • Kyari Magumeri (1897–1972), was a Nigerian Army officer who fought in both World Wars
  • Laminu Njitiya (died 1871), 19th-century fief-holder of Magumeri
